The Role:

As an integral member of Hadrian’s Special Projects division, you will work closely with the weld development team and engineering leadership on advanced R&D initiatives and customer-driven innovation. This division plays a dual role—leading moonshot engineering efforts and contributing expert guidance to new business opportunities.

We are seeking a skilled Welding Specialist to help establish and scale a high-performance fabrication and automation operation. This is a hands-on, technical role designed for a welding expert who excels in precision craftsmanship, process optimization, and collaborative problem-solving. You will support manual and robotic welding operations as part of a broader mission to develop manufacturing solutions for aerospace, automotive, maritime, and defense applications.

Your responsibilities will include, but not be limited to, the following:

  • Perform precision welding of aluminum and steel using GMAW and GTAW processes to meet industry and project-specific standards.

  • Interpret welding codes, blueprints, CAD models, and welding procedure specifications (WPS), including standards such as AWS D1.2.

  • Diagnose and troubleshoot weld-related issues such as distortion, porosity, and fusion defects; develop and implement corrective actions.

  • Support welding inspections (visual, bend, NDT prep) and collaborate with engineers and quality assurance teams on process validation and qualification.

  • Maintain and calibrate welding equipment and support robotic, mechanized, and manual welding systems as required.

What We’re Looking For:

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; completion of trade school or technical certification preferred.

  • Minimum 6 years of experience in welding, with demonstrated expertise in GMAW and GTAW processes.

  • Proven ability to weld aluminum and steel with a strong understanding of weld techniques, joint design, and distortion control.

  • Experience interpreting engineering drawings and working with part fixturing and lifting systems.

  • Familiarity with welding in varied environments, including confined spaces, elevated work areas, and hot work conditions.

What Will Set You Apart:

  • Experience supporting or integrating robotic welding systems or automation in a production environment.

  • Ability to interpret nondestructive testing (NDT) results such as radiographic (x-ray) data for quality analysis.

  • Prior experience mentoring, training, or assessing the skill levels of team members in a fabrication setting.

  • Demonstrated cross-functional collaboration skills and the ability to contribute to process improvement initiatives.

ITAR Requirements

To conform to U.S. Government space technology export regulations, including the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) you must be a U.S. citizen, lawful permanent resident of the U.S., protected individual as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3), or e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
